  • Urban transit operation is to manipulate the vehicle or train of urban transit to be operated on the basis of the installations such as track, power, communication, signaling and so on. It can be performed by manual or automated, or manned or manless operation considering its system built, operation efficiency, safety, etc. Because of the heavy impact directly to the safety of passenger transport, it has been managed strictly by the Regulation for Train Operation of Urban Transit according to Urban Transit Act. However, the present regulation has been basis of the manual operation mainly, it is crossing beyond the limitation of application to the manless operation which is being introduced moment to moment. It is needed increasingly to revise the regulation for the manless operation which is close at hand now. In this paper, we examined and analysed the cases of manless operation of urban transit planed within the country such as Busan 4th Line, Shinbundang Line, Busan-Kimhae Line, etc. based on the present regulation, and proposed the review of considerations to reflec the manless operation to the regulation to be revised.

  • LRT(Light Rail Transit) is currently adopting a more upgraded signal system these days. This latest signal system is a train on-board signal system with moving block based on the realtime bi-directional wireless communications. The system applies RF-CBTC(Radio Frequency - Communication Based Train Control System) in order th execute fully automated manless operation. This paper reviews the performance requirements and safety of RF-CBTC that will be applied to the fully automated manless operation for LRT.

  • In this study. a traveling control system was developed to transfer a machine without an operator in the working zone. The dimension of the system was modelized to design and construct smaller than that of real configuration of a greenhouse. For this system, the fixed path type was used to detect exact position during operating a manless machine. and the X-Y table actuator type to escape a unique path, which had the disadvantage in a fixed path type environment. Based on the results of this research the following conclusions were made : 1. This system used two screws to move toward horizontal direction, and a Plate to reach at any points in the working zone. 2. The software combined the functions of path selection and motor operation to control into one program. The path selection program was a menu driven program written in Visual Basic, and the motor operation program was written in Borland C++ for actuating motors. 3. The path-select mode of the program was used by selecting the desired paths, and the user path-create mode by selecting a random path in the path-selection program. 4. The system proved to be a reliable system for operating a manless machine, since accuracy and precision to reach the positions were less than 1%.

  • Generator excitation system, supplying the voltage to power system, is controlled by various manners as aspects of power system. Previously excitation systems mainly used AVR(Automatic Voltage Regulator) and FCR(Field Current Regulator) to control voltage, but nowadays the excitation systems have the tendency to adopt AQR(Automatic Reactive power Regulator) and APFR(Automatic Power Factor Regulator) to do it so as to get into step with diverse requirements of power system and high digital technology. This paper presents which operation methods is effective for the equipment, according to increase the unmanned power station thanks to automation technic.

  • In this paper, criterion and algorithm for on-line dissolved gas of a Power transformer are studied. For the initial diagnosis of a power transformer, the on-line dissolved gas analysis is one of the most important and acceptable item to preventively diagnose a power transformer. But the criterion and algorithm of this item are not established yet in korea. In this paper, criterion and alarm level of the on-line dissolved gas analysis are based on the analysis of on-line data of operating transformers, Korea industrial standard and operation manual for a power transformer as well as accumulated data of the preventive diagnosis systems which have been operated at nine substations of Korea Electric Power Co.(KEPCO) since 1997, Therefore, the criterion and alarm level proposed in this paper are to be well suitable and are adaptable for the domestic operational environments and conditions of the power transformer. Considering that the conventional diagnosis system is capable only of accumulating and monitoring data of the power transformer operation, the criteria and the algorithms make it possible to accomplish an ultimate goal of the preventive diagnosis system. It is expected, therefore, that they will have a beneficial effect on broad applications of the preventive diagnosis system and the achievement of manless substation system in the future.
